机器学习是人工智能的一个重要分支,它使用算法让计算机系统从数据中学习并做出决策或预测。机器学习算法可以分为两类:传统机器学习算法和深度学习算法。
传统机器学习算法是一种基础的机器学习方法,它们通常使用线性模型来处理数据。这些算法包括逻辑回归、朴素贝叶斯、决策树等。传统机器学习算法的主要优点是简单易懂,易于实现,且在处理大规模数据集时表现出色。然而,它们也存在一些缺点,如过拟合、对数据的分布假设过于严格等。
深度学习算法是一类基于神经网络的机器学习方法,它们可以处理复杂的非线性关系。深度学习算法主要包括卷积神经网络(CNN)、循环神经网络(RNN)和长短期记忆网络(LSTM)等。深度学习算法的主要优点是可以自动提取特征,对数据进行深层次的学习,因此在某些任务上具有更高的准确率。然而,深度学习算法也面临一些挑战,如过拟合、训练时间长、计算成本高等问题。
总的来说,传统机器学习算法和深度学习算法各有优缺点,适用于不同的应用场景。在选择使用哪种算法时,需要根据具体的任务需求、数据特征和计算资源等因素进行综合考虑。